Firefighters and Local Police officers from Haría prevented a person from committing suicide at approximately 5:40 p.m. this Monday in the Gallo area, near Guinate, as reported by the Emergency Consortium.
The Emergency Coordination Center (CECOES) alerted the Local Police of Haría to a suicide attempt in the Gallo area, so they went to the scene. The officers informed the firefighters that they did not know the man's location, as he was sending confusing messages.
After searching the area, the Local Police located the person and spoke with them, who was in good health.
Authorities emphasize the importance of seeking help in situations of emotional crisis. The Ministry of Health reminds that the 024 Line is available free of charge and confidentially to assist people with suicidal thoughts, as well as their family members and loved ones.
